Danijel Dejan Djuric (born 5 January 2003) is a professional footballer who plays as a forward for Icelandic club Víkingur Reykjavík. Born in Bulgaria to a Serbian father and a Bulgarian mother, he plays for the Iceland national team.
Born in Bulgaria to a Bulgarian mother and Serbian father, Djuric moved to Iceland aged two.[1][6] His first youth club was Hvöt from Blönduós, before joining Breiðablik when his family moved to Kópavogur in 2012.[1][3] In 2019, he transferred to the youth side of Danish club FC Midtjylland.[3]
In July 2022, Djuric started his senior career when he transferred to Víkingur Reykjavík from Midtjylland.[5]
He has featured for the U15, U16, U17, U18, U19 and U21 youth teams of Iceland.[4] He made his debut with the senior team in a friendly match against South Korea on 11 November 2022, playing the first 73 minutes.[7]
